有客户反映,在wince系统下,复制文件时不能取消,点击关闭文件复制对话框后,出现卡顿现象。
如上图所示,左边是复制文件时无“取消”按钮,而右边有。
左边是我自己编译的nk,而右边是开发板自带的nk。
一开始,我们以为是没有更新升级包的原因,但是在更新后,该现象仍然存在。
接着分析可能是组件选择不同,在经过一些测试后,验证了这个想法。
产生这个问题的原因是,因为我们这款设备使用的显示屏分辨率为320x240,
所以选择了Shell and User Interface\User Interface\Quarter VGA Resources - Portrait Mode组件,
将该选项去掉后,“取消”按钮就出现了。
关于卡顿现象:是因为关闭对话框后,复制操作并没有终止,所以等文件复制完成后,系统运行便恢复正常。